The Role

As a Housing Officer, you will play a crucial role in supporting the housing and income team to ensure tenants' well-being and financial stability.

Specifically, you will seek to reduce void properties and help vulnerable refugee tenants maintain their tenancies.

Assisting the Team Leader and Housing Income Officer with tenant assessments, you will make accommodation offers and sign-up new tenants. You will help manage and maximise property rental income and ensure service charges are within agreed budgets.

In this role, you will aid in estate management services, including settling in visits for new tenants and conducting property inspections. Liaising with the cleaning team, you will ensure estates are clean and presentable, report issues and investigate tenancy problems such as anti-social behaviour.

Additionally, your role will involve:

- Handling complaints promptly and effectively, resolving issues where possible
- Negotiating debt payment arrangements based on tenant income and expenditure

About You

To be considered as a Housing Officer, you will need:

- Experience of working with asylum seekers or refugees in a voluntary or paid capacity
- Previous experience in working with service users who speak a different language
- Knowledge of the Homelessness Legislation particularly the 2002 Homelessness Act
- Organisational skills in terms of service planning, prioritising work, time management, effective use of resources and performance evaluation
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
- The ability to work in a fast-paced and sometimes pressurised environment
- To be comfortable and able to deal with individuals or subject matter that can be emotive and demanding
